When it comes to protecting your home or commercial building from water damage, PVC waterproofing is a reliable choice. PVC, or polyvinyl chloride, is a durable and versatile material that is widely used in waterproofing applications. This method involves applying PVC membranes to surfaces to create an effective barrier against moisture. Whether you are dealing with roofs, basements, or foundations, PVC waterproofing can help prevent leaks and structural damage, ensuring your property remains safe and dry.
Many homeowners and contractors prefer PVC waterproofing due to its proven quality and longevity. Here are some key benefits of using PVC waterproofing:
- Durability: PVC membranes are resistant to tears, punctures, and degradation from UV exposure.
- Flexibility: They can adapt to various surfaces and shapes, making installation easier.
- Cost-Effective: PVC waterproofing can save you money in the long run by reducing the need for repairs caused by water damage.
- Environmentally Friendly: Many PVC products are recyclable, contributing to sustainable building practices.
